Django é um framework web de alto nível, escrito em Python, que estimula o desenvolvimento rápido e limpo.
Nível Intermediário Categoria Desenvolvimento Back-end
O Django é um framework para desenvolvimento web escrito em Python. Ele provê diversos mecanismos para o desenvolvimento da aplicações web completas de forma rápida e fácil. Inicialmente desenvolvido pensando na criação de aplicações rápidas, o Django possui diversos recursos para otimização em todo o processo de desenvolvimento de nossa aplicação, como veremos ao longo do curso.
Portanto, veremos neste curso como funciona o Django e como implementar uma aplicação com acesso ao banco de dados com validações tanto no Back-end quanto no Front-end. Tudo isso utilizando o Python \
O Django é um framework para desenvolvimento web escrito em Python. Ele provê diversos mecanismos para o desenvolvimento da aplicações web completas de forma rápida e fácil. Inicialmente desenvolvido pensando na criação de aplicações rápidas, o Django possui diversos recursos para otimização em todo o processo de desenvolvimento de nossa aplicação, como veremos ao longo do curso.
Portanto, veremos neste curso como funciona o Django e como implementar uma aplicação com acesso ao banco de dados com validações tanto no Back-end quanto no Front-end. Tudo isso utilizando o Python \
Neste curso abordaremos os principais conceitos a cerca do Django, além disso, veremos todas as funcionalidades oferecidas por este framework e como utilizá-las. São vídeo aulas e apostilas que mostram os principais conceitos do Django. Também serão passados exercícios para que você possa fixar, praticar e aplicar o conteúdo aprendido durante o curso.
Dentre várias outras coisas, você verá:
Este curso é voltado para desenvolvedores que já possua conhecimentos intermediários no Python e desejam criar aplicações web com esta linguagem.
Os pré-requisitos não são obrigatórios, são apenas sugestões. Eles dão uma base de parte do conhecimento que é interessante ter para um bom aproveitamento nesse curso.
Professor na TreinaWeb e graduado em Sistemas de Informação pelo Instituto Federal da Bahia. Apaixonado por desenvolvimento web, desktop e mobile desde os 12 anos de idade. Já utilizou todos os sistemas operacionais possíveis, mas hoje se contenta com o OSX instalado em seu notebook Samsung =/. Até passou em uma peneira do Cruzeiro, mas preferiu estudar Python.
Introdução ao curso.
7 aulasNesta aula veremos como funciona a arquitetura do Django e seu padrão de arquitetura, o MTV.
2 aulasNesta aula veremos como funciona o HTTP, protocolo utilizado para realizar as chamadas e requisitar dados para nossa aplicação.
1 aulaNesta aula veremos como conectar nossa aplicação ao banco de dados MySQL.
3 aulasNesta aula veremos para quê e como funciona a camada model.
4 aulasNesta aula veremos como funciona a camada view e como criá-la em nosso projeto.
5 aulasNesta aula veremos como funcionam as rotas utilizadas para executar os métodos da view em nosso projeto.
3 aulasNesta aula veremos como funcionam os templates em nosso projeto e qual a sua finalidade.
3 aulasNesta aula veremos como criar o método de inserção de clientes em nosso projeto.
6 aulasNesta aula veremos como melhorar os templates do nosso projeto.
6 aulasNesta aula veremos como criar o método para exibir um cliente por ID em nosso CRUD de clientes.
3 aulasNesta aula veremos como editar os clientes existentes em nosso banco de dados através da aplicação.
3 aulasNesta aula veremos como desenvolver o método para remover clientes do nosso banco de dados.
3 aulasNesta aula veremos como criar uma camada extra para comportar os métodos de manipulação do banco de dados e remover essa responsabilidade das nossas views.
3 aulasNesta aula veremos alguns dos principais pontos sobre a segurança do Django e como ela funciona.
4 aulasTenha um ano de acesso completo a todos os cursos da plataforma, incluindo novos lançamentos, mentoria de carreira e suporte direto com os professores!
Contrate agora e tenha acesso ilimitado a todo o nosso portfólio. Isso inclui:
Confiamos tanto nos resultados dos nossos cursos, que criamos uma garantia incondicional de satisfação para você, que são 7 dias de teste!